HI3-0200-5Z Equivalent & Substitute Parts
Part Overview
The HI3-0200-5Z is a 2-circuit IC switch manufactured by Renesas Electronics Corporation, configured as SPST-NC (Single Pole Single Throw - Normally Closed) with 1:1 multiplexer/demultiplexer functionality. The device features 80Ohm on-state resistance and operates with dual supply voltage (±15V). This part is classified as obsolete, making identification of functionally equivalent alternatives essential for ongoing system support and new design implementations.

Key Parameters
| Parameter | Value |
|---|---|
| Switch Circuit Configuration | SPST - NC |
| Number of Circuits | 2 |
| Multiplexer/Demultiplexer Ratio | 1:1 |
| On-State Resistance (Max) | 80Ohm |
| Dual Supply Voltage (V±) | ±15V |
| Switch Time - Ton (Max) | 240ns |
| Switch Time - Toff (Max) | 500ns |
| Channel Capacitance (CS(off), CD(off)) | 5.5pF, 5.5pF |
| Current - Leakage (IS(off)) (Max) | 500nA |
| Operating Temperature Range | 0°C ~ 75°C |
| Package / Case | 14-DIP (0.300", 7.62mm) |
| Mounting Type | Through Hole |
| RoHS Status | ROHS3 Compliant |
Substitute Part Grouping Explanation
Substitution of the HI3-0200-5Z is determined by strict alignment of the following electrical and mechanical parameters:
- Switch circuit configuration (SPST - NC topology)
- Number of circuits (2 circuits minimum)
- Multiplexer/demultiplexer ratio (1:1)
- On-state resistance (80Ohm maximum)
- Dual supply voltage compatibility (±15V operation)
- Package form factor (14-DIP through-hole)
- Compliance certifications (RoHS3, REACH)
The DG200ACJ+ from Analog Devices Inc./Maxim Integrated meets these core substitution criteria. While certain electrical characteristics differ (supply voltage range, leakage current, channel capacitance), the part maintains functional equivalence for SPST-NC switching applications requiring 80Ohm on-state resistance in a 14-DIP package.
Parameter Comparison
| Parameter | HI3-0200-5Z (Renesas) | DG200ACJ+ (Analog Devices/Maxim) |
|---|---|---|
| Switch Circuit | SPST - NC | SPST - NC |
| Number of Circuits | 2 | 2 |
| Multiplexer/Demultiplexer Ratio | 1:1 | 1:1 |
| On-State Resistance (Max) | 80Ohm | 80Ohm |
| Dual Supply Voltage (V±) | ±15V | ±4.5V ~ 18V |
| Switch Time - Ton (Max) | 240ns | 1µs |
| Switch Time - Toff (Max) | 500ns | 500ns |
| Channel Capacitance (CS(off), CD(off)) | 5.5pF, 5.5pF | 9pF, 9pF |
| Current - Leakage (IS(off)) (Max) | 500nA | 2nA |
| Operating Temperature Range | 0°C ~ 75°C | 0°C ~ 70°C |
| Package / Case | 14-DIP (0.300", 7.62mm) | 14-DIP (0.300", 7.62mm) |
| Mounting Type | Through Hole | Through Hole |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ant |
| Product Status | Obsolete | Active |
Engineering Selection Recommendations
The DG200ACJ+ is suitable as a direct substitute for the HI3-0200-5Z based on the following factors:
- Both parts maintain identical switch circuit topology (SPST - NC) and on-state resistance specification (80Ohm)
- Package compatibility is confirmed (14-DIP through-hole form factor)
- The DG200ACJ+ operates within the ±15V supply requirement of the original design (specified range: ±4.5V ~ 18V)
- Both parts are RoHS3 compliant and REACH unaffected, meeting current regulatory requirements
- The DG200ACJ+ is active product status, ensuring long-term availability and supply chain stability
Differences in switching time (Ton), channel capacitance, and leakage current must be evaluated within the context of specific circuit requirements. The DG200ACJ+ exhibits faster Toff performance (500ns match) but slower Ton (1µs vs. 240ns). Higher channel capacitance (9pF vs. 5.5pF) and significantly lower leakage current (2nA vs. 500nA) may impact high-frequency or precision analog applications.
Frequently Asked Questions (FAQ)
Q: Can the DG200ACJ+ replace the HI3-0200-5Z in existing designs?
A: Yes, for applications where the core switching function (SPST - NC, 80Ohm, 2 circuits, 1:1 ratio) is the primary requirement. Circuit-level validation is necessary if timing specifications or leakage current performance are critical to system operation.
Q: What are the key differences between these parts?
A: The primary differences are supply voltage range (DG200ACJ+ supports ±4.5V ~ 18V vs. fixed ±15V), turn-on time (1µs vs. 240ns), channel capacitance (9pF vs. 5.5pF), and leakage current (2nA vs. 500nA). The DG200ACJ+ also has a narrower operating temperature range (0°C ~ 70°C vs. 0°C ~ 75°C).
Q: Are both parts available in the same package?
A: Yes, both the HI3-0200-5Z and DG200ACJ+ are packaged in 14-DIP (0.300", 7.62mm) through-hole form factor with identical pinout compatibility.
Q: What compliance certifications apply to both parts?
A: Both parts are RoHS3 compliant and REACH unaffected, meeting current environmental and regulatory standards for electronic components.
